Luxury Living Rating

Spanos Park East ranks as one of the best-regarded luxury neighborhoods in town, with a score of 2.0 out of 4. Luxury Lifestyle Scoring is based on having high-end community amenities like pools, saunas, workout spaces, maid services, and kitchen details like granite and high-end fixtures. Luxury submarkets also often offer tile, hardwood, and fine carpeting, raquetball courts, and for some communities, even a doorman to greet residents.

Frequently Asked Questions about Spanos Park East

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Spanos Park East c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Spanos Park East range from $1,530 to $2,295.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,022.
